Top 5 Tips To Hold A Successful Conference

 
by John L Jones

In case you have a plan on organizing a conference, then you must make sure that you are prepared to not only offer great content but also great comfort to all the participants. Conferences are considered to be the best place for people to come together and talk about policies; but, uncomfortable settings can make it complicated for participants to use their full potential, and can further harm the conference ambiance as well.

Following are five tips on how to organize a great conference:

1. Great Content: Make sure that the theme the conference is being hosted on is very attention-grabbing. If you are arranging a conference for a particular industry, then try and get distinguished people from within it to come and speak at the event. Make sure you choose a Chairperson who is well aware of the topic and is able to converse on it, as well as encourage other people to participate in the conference.

2. Proactive Participants: When making a decision on a way to get participants to register, make sure you attract the finest people. Having people at the conference who know and are interested in the topic will make it easier for the conference to become successful. In addition, Make sure you publicize the conference through different media to get an extensive coverage.

3. Good Food: Nothing ruins a conference as quickly as either bad food, or lack of water. Humans are not able to function properly when either hungry or thirsty, so make sure you talk about it to the event manager beforehand about the food that will be offered. Make sure that the food offered has variety and is of standard quality. Moreover, also cater to incorporate any dietetic restrictions some participants might have (like vegetarian options).

Make sure food is offered at regular intervals with snacks and coffee in between as people are habitual of having something every four to five hours. Provide enough time in plan for everyone to get food and enjoy it completely before rushing back to the conference sessions.

4. Friendly Service: If you have volunteers helping you, make sure you train them to be very welcoming and polite to all the guests. As the participants will be working all day long, there is a possibility that they might become aggressive or discourteous when being asked for changes in rooms or other issue that might take place. No other thing will make them more angry or unhappy than a volunteer who is discourteous to them. Given that these participants are your guests, make sure you treat them courteously throughout their stay.

5. Lodging and other extras: If you are supplying overnight stay facilities, check that the rooms are clean and have proper heating or cooling systems. Notify participants who will be staying over their room numbers when they register, and tell them of any hotel amenities or limitations (all keys at reception, no phone calls from etc) so that they have full information with them.

Apart from the rooms, take into consideration other things you can offer your guests. It might be probable to get snacks or drinks company to sponsor the conference so you are able to offer participants complimentary snacks other than the ones the hotel provides. Moreover it would be great to get a little reminder of the conference, so consider getting t-shirts, key rings, or mugs made depending on the demographics of the participants.
